The Echoes of the Past: Historical Roots of *Tarian Kalimantan Utara*

The dances of North Kalimantan are deeply rooted in the region's history, influenced by various cultural interactions and historical events. The indigenous communities, including the Dayak, Lun Bawang, and Tidung, have long preserved their traditions through dance. These dances often depict historical events, myths, and legends, serving as a powerful tool for transmitting knowledge and values across generations. For instance, the *Tari Giring* of the Dayak people, characterized by its energetic movements and intricate formations, is believed to have originated from ancient rituals related to hunting and warfare. Similarly, the *Tari Jepen* of the Lun Bawang community, with its graceful steps and elegant costumes, reflects the cultural practices and social interactions of the people. These dances serve as a tangible link to the past, reminding the present generation of their ancestors' struggles, triumphs, and beliefs.

A Tapestry of Culture: The Diverse Forms of *Tarian Kalimantan Utara*

The diverse ethnic groups of North Kalimantan have contributed to a rich tapestry of dance forms, each with its unique characteristics and cultural significance. The *Tari Giring*, mentioned earlier, is just one example of the many dances performed by the Dayak people. Other popular Dayak dances include the *Tari Hudoq*, a ritualistic dance performed during harvest festivals, and the *Tari Kancet*, a lively dance that celebrates the joy of life. The Lun Bawang community, known for their intricate weaving and craftsmanship, also has a vibrant dance tradition. The *Tari Jepen*, with its graceful movements and elegant costumes, is a popular dance performed during special occasions. The Tidung people, known for their maritime heritage, have dances like the *Tari Perahu Layar*, which depicts the graceful movements of sailing boats. These dances not only showcase the cultural diversity of North Kalimantan but also highlight the unique traditions and practices of each ethnic group.
